Stage 1 Foods


Eva turned 5 months old on Sunday and we decided to go ahead and try her on some stage 1 food. She was getting tired of the rice cereal and was taking an active interest in whatever we are eating or drinking. So I decided to start off with some yellow squash. My sister suggested that I purchase a jar first to make sure that she liked it before making my own - but I just really didn't want to give her food from a jar.

So I bought the squash and boiled it until soft. Then I used Amy's Foley food mill to mush it down.

Gilbert fed it to her and she really seemed to like it!

So I am going to the store tomorrow to buy some more squash for her. But this time I am going to steam it instead of boiling - to make sure all the nutrients don't get boiled into the water! If all goes well the next few days with the squash, I am going to try zucchini next, then maybe green beans and peas. I want to save the sweeter veggies like carrots and sweet potatoes for later.
